>> I was wondering what the status of the Geometry Manager is currently.
>> Does it work as expected, or is it broken?
>> 
>> Do any of you use it?  Is it worth trying to make it work, or should I
>> just write my own routines to handle stack resizing situations?
> 

Rick,

As far as I know the GM is good for simple rearranging of a few objects, but 
can quickly become overwhelmed by a complex layout. I, and I think many other 
developers, prefer to roll our own on a card-by-card basis. It can become 
tedious with lots of controls to arrange, but once it’s set up, it’s fast and 
reliable.
